Calvary Baptist Theological Seminary is in Lansdale, PA, is private and nonprofit, is Baptist, grants doctorates, is on the semester system, its top Masters major is divinity/ministry, its top Doctoral major is theology and religious vocations, other, and enrolls fewer than 1,000 students.
